* Package name : horde3-passwd
* Version : 3.0
* Upstream Author : Horde Group
* URL : http://ftp.horde.org/pub/passwd/
* License : Own License
* Description :
Passwd is the Horde password changing application.  Right now, Passwd provi=
des
fairly complete support for changing passwords via Poppassd, LDAP, Unix exp=
ect
scripts, the Unix smbpasswd command for SMB/CIFS passwords, Kolab, ADSI, Pi=
ne,
Serv-U FTP, VMailMgr, vpopmail, and SQL passwords.
